“Voice of God,” Bob Sheppard at Peace


‘Voice of God’ and Well-known Yankee announcer and Bob Sheppard has passed away at the age of 99.  Bob Sheppard served as the public address

announcer for three local teams in three different sports.  The Yankees (1951-2007) as well as the NY Football Giants (1956-2006) as well as for St John’s Basketball and varsity Football teams until the early 1990’s

Bob Sheppard last worked at Yankee stadium late in the 2007 season, when he became sick with a bronchial infection. Bob Sheppard recorded a greeting to fans that was played at the original ballpark’s final game in September 2008.

Bob Sheppard’s death was confirmed to The Associated Press on Sunday by team spokesman Jason Zillo. Zillo didn’t immediately have additional details.
